0.12.0

In this release we had a little focus on:

  1. Primitives and constants and how to use them

  2. Strings and numbers and how to write them

  3. OOP features

  4. Blocks and code structure, including variable scoping and overlaping variables

  5. Overused expressions and new complexity metrics

Features

  • Breaking: moves ImplicitInConditionViolation from WPS336 to WPS514

  • Breaking: now ExplicitStringConcatViolation uses WPS336

  • Breaking: moves YieldMagicMethodViolation from WPS435 to WPS611

  • Adds xenon as a dependency, it also checks for cyclomatic complexity, but uses more advanced algorithm with better results

  • Forbids to have modules with too many imported names configured by --max-imported-names option which is 50 by default

  • Forbids to raise StopIteration inside generators

  • Forbids to have incorrect method order inside classes

  • Forbids to make some magic methods async

  • Forbids to use meaningless zeros in float, binary, octal, hex, and expanentional numbers

  • Enforces to use 1e10 instead of 1e+10

  • Enforces to use big letters for hex numbers: 0xAB instead of 0xab

  • Enforces to use r'\n' instead of '\\n'

  • Forbids to have unicode escape characters inside binary strings

  • Forbids to use else if instead of elif

  • Forbids to have too long try bodies, basically try bodies with more than one statement

  • Forbids to overlap local and block variables

  • Forbids to use block variables after the block definitions

  • Changes how WrongSlotsViolation works, now (...) + value is restricted in favor of (..., *value)

  • Forbids to have explicit unhashable types in sets and dicts

  • Forbids to define useless overwritten methods

  • Enforces j prefix over J for complex numbers

  • Forbids overused expressions

  • Forbids explicit 0 division, multiply, pow, addition, and substraction

  • Fordids to pow, multiply, or divide by 1

  • Forbids to use expressions like x + -2, or y - -1, or z -= -1

  • Forbids to multiply lists like [0] * 2

  • Forbids to use variable names like __ and _____

  • Forbids to define unused variables explicitly: _unused = 2

  • Forbids to shadow outer scope variables with local ones

  • Forbids to have too many assert statements in a function

  • Forbids to have explicit string contact: 'a' + some_data, use .format()

  • Now YieldInsideInitViolation is named YieldMagicMethodViolation and it also checks different magic methods in a class

  • Forbids to use assert False and other false-constants

  • Forbids to use while False: and other false-constants

  • Forbids to use open() outside of with

  • Forbids to use type() for compares

  • Forbids to have consecutive expressions with too deep access level

  • Forbids to have too many public instance attributes

  • Forbids to use pointless star operations: print(*[])

  • Forbids to use range(len(some)), use enumerate(some) instead

  • Forbids to use implicit sum() calls and replace them with loops

  • Forbids to compare with the falsy constants like if some == []:

0.11.0 aka The New Violation Codes

We had a really big problem: all violations inside best_practices was messed up together with no clear structure.

We had to fix it before it is too late. So, we broke existing error codes. And now we can promise not to do it ever again.

We also have this nice migration guide for you to rename your violations with a script.

Features

  • Breaking: replaces Z error code to WPS code

  • Breaking: creates new violation group refactoring.py

  • Breaking: creates new violation group oop.py

  • Breaking: moving a lot of violations from best_practices to refactoring, oop, and consistency

  • Adds new wemake formatter (using it now by default)

0.10.0 aka The Great Compare

This release is mostly targeted at writing better compares and conditions. We introduce a lot of new rules related to this topic improving: consistency, complexity, and general feel from your code.

In this release we have ported a lot of existing pylint rules, big cudos to the developers of this wonderful tool.

Features

  • Adds flake8-executable as a dependency

  • Adds flake8-rst-docstrings as a dependency

  • Validates options that are passed with flake8

  • Forbids to use module level mutable constants

  • Forbids to over-use strings

  • Forbids to use breakpoint function

  • Limits yield tuple lengths

  • Forbids to have too many await statements

  • Forbids to subclass lowercase builtins

  • Forbids to have useless lambdas

  • Forbids to use len(sized) > 0 and if len(sized) style checks

  • Forbids to use repeatable conditions: flag or flag

  • Forbids to write conditions like not some > 1

  • Forbids to use heterogenous compares like x == x > 0

  • Forbids to use complex compare with several items (>= 3)

  • Forbids to have class variables that are shadowed by instance variables

  • Forbids to use ternary expressions inside if conditions

  • Forces to use ternary instead of ... and ... or ... expression

  • Forces to use c < b < a instead of a > b and b > c

  • Forces to use c < b < a instead of a > b > c

  • Forbids to use explicit in [] and in (), use sets or variables instead

  • Forces to write isinstance(some, (A, B)) instead of isinstance(some, A) or isinstance(some, B)

  • Forbids to use isinstance(some (A,))

  • Forces to merge a == b or a == c into a in {b, c} and to merge a != b and a != c into a not in {b, c}
